Breast Cancer | Disease Landscape and Forecast | G7 | 2025

CDK4/6 inhibitors (Pfizer’s palbociclib, Novartis’s ribociclib, and Eli Lilly’s abemaciclib) combined with endocrine therapy are central to the treatment of metastatic HR-positive / HER2-negative disease, and we expect them to drive robust sales in the early-stage setting. Novel biomarker-driven therapies (Novartis’s alpelisib, AstraZeneca´s capivasertib, and Menarini´s elacestrant) are effective treatment options, and the market will become increasingly crowded with agents seeking to tackle endocrine resistance. HER2-positive breast cancer treatment is rapidly evolving owing to approval and forecast label expansions for agents such as trastuzumab deruxtecan (Daiichi Sankyo / AstraZeneca), which has also emerged as a key therapy for the newly defined HER2-low and HER2-ultra-low subgroups. In triple-negative breast cancer, Merck & Co.’s immune checkpoint inhibitor pembrolizumab is the standard of care, and Gilead’s TROP2-targeted agent sacituzumab govitecan, currently used in the pretreated metastatic setting, aims to expand to more lucrative earlier lines of treatment.

Geography: United States, EU5, Japan

Primary research: Country-specific interviews with thought-leading medical oncologists; survey data collected for this and other Clarivate research

Epidemiology: Diagnosed incidence of breast cancer by country; histology, stage, and line of therapy, segmented into relevant drug-treatable populations

Forecast: 10-year, annualized, drug-level sales and patient share of key breast cancer therapies through 2034, segmented by brands and epidemiological subpopulations

Drug treatments: Coverage of select current and emerging therapies
